Step aboard ISLAND JEWEL, a 2019 Aquila 36 Sport that brings together performance, comfort, and versatility in a way few boats in this class can match. Professionally maintained and lightly used, she’s the ideal platform for effortless island cruising or a premium day-charter experience.
Powered by twin Mercury Verado 350s, she offers quick acceleration, confident handling, and a smooth, stable ride—perfect for hopping between anchorages or exploring farther afield. From quiet coves to lively waterfronts, she makes every trip easy and enjoyable.
Her exterior spaces are made for relaxed days on the water. The cockpit flows naturally into the forward seating and sun pad areas, creating plenty of room for guests to lounge, dine, or enjoy the sunset. Whether you’re entertaining friends or spending the day with family, the layout keeps everyone connected and comfortable.
Below, two well-appointed cabins—each with its own en-suite—make overnights surprisingly comfortable for a boat her size. The interiors are bright, clean, and modern, giving the spaces a welcoming, retreat-like feel.
For private owners and charter operators alike, ISLAND JEWEL is a standout option. Her efficient design, generous deck space, and proven ride quality make her an excellent choice for day trips, cruising between islands, or offering guests a memorable time on the water.
In short, she’s a versatile, stylish, and well-kept Aquila 36 Sport—ready for her next adventure and her next owner.
